When surfers are looking for the best deal price may not be the only clincher. Innumerable high speed internet access organisations will show an unusually low entry package to get budding customers over to them. When high speed packages are exceedingly low in money please make sure you find out what broadband speed the broadband service provider will provide, what download limits you will be provided with and also the length of the broadband contract. The download allocation is vital as innumerable internet providers will probably charge browsers per GB that potential customers go over, so if your internet package has an 8GB download allocation and surfers download ten Hollywood movies that month, you are more than likely to have downloaded 10GB (i.e. one Gigabyte per movie) – that is 2GB’s beyond your download allocation, and which is two GB worth of internet downloads the firm will probably charge over and above your monthly package cost.
When looking at the very best offer please also check whether or not the provider will charge a connection fee and if there are any costs associated with being provided a wireless internet router. All the above additional charges may all mount up and internet users will probably be left with little savings when compared to other internet packages.
